Why These Connect
The narrative assertion
"The Doctor and Romana's conversation about time as both philosophical and geographical (E5) foreshadows their encounter with Kerensky's time experiment (E6), where time becomes a manipulable science."

Why This Matters Across Episodes
The longer arc this connection carries
The dual framing of time (philosophy vs. science) established in E5 is realized in E6 where time is physically manipulated, showing how the Doctor's rhetorical distinction between types of time becomes literal.
